Your benefits
We recognise that taking regular breaks from work is important. The College offers full
time support staff up to 44 days off per year (this includes 28 days annual leave, 8 bank holidays and
a period of operational closure at Christmas closure (which has been 8 days in recent years). You will
also have the opportunity to join the Local Government Pension scheme, find out more at
www.lgpsmember.org.

All posts at Exeter College are exempt from the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(ROA) 1974. The
amendments to the ROA 1974 (Exceptions Order 1975, (amended 2013 and 2020)) provide that when
applying for certain jobs and activities, certain spent convictions and cautions are 'protected', so they
do not need to be disclosed to employers, and if they are disclosed, employers cannot take them into
account. The MOJ's guidance on the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974 and the Exceptions Order
1975, provides information about which convictions must be declared during job applications and
related exceptions and further inform.
